This striking and moving documentary traces the extraordinary life of Rudolf Nureyev, the most famous male dancer that transcended fame in the dance world to become a pop culture icon of his time, and an enduring inspiration for dancers everywhere. It charts his rise from humble beginnings, to his eventual defection to the West, an event that shocked the world. We follow his career as he went from strength to strength, and come to understand his enigmatic and explosive personality through anecdotes from his dearest friends. This film contextualises not just the man but also the times in which he lived, discussing the politically charged divide between Russia and the West and the critical role that Nureyev played as a cultural and global phenomena.
